Chart Stacker System

Hi Everyone,

Since it is a slow afternoon I wanted to share a system I have been working on for quite a while now, as it has improved my trading immensely. This has been cobbled together from indicators on this forum, so many thanks to the indies authors and all the great members, I hope some of you find it helps you. This system provides fewer entries, but very high probability trade setups. It uses the gbpjpy, the gbpusd and the usdjpy. These pairs are then stacked so you are looking at the gbpjpy chart in it's entirety, and can see the volumes and indicators of the other 2 pairs beneath that chart. This can also be used to trade the eurjpy, using the eurjpy, eurusd and usdjpy pairs and stacking them up.

Entry Rules:
Use the 2 moving averages to determine trend direction and ONLY trade the trend direction.

For long trades:

Wait for the vertical RSI bars to be positive on ALL 3 pairs.
Wait for the BB bands indicator to turn blue on ALL 3 pairs.
Wait for the RSIOMA to be crossing upward on ALL 3 pairs.

Exit Rules:
Wait for a spike in volume to signal a change in price direction.

For shorts it is the opposite:

RSI bars negative on all 3 pairs
BB bands indicator red on all 3 pairs
RSIOMA crossing downwards on all 3 pairs

Same exit rules, watch for a volume spike.

I usually trade from 1 am est till I get tired at least untill 10 am est, find the best trades start about 2-3 am est. I ALWAYS avoid the news! The only way I will leave a trade open thru any news announcement is if I have already had a big move and taken profit on half the position with a stop at break even on the rest.
